Laravel是一款很受歡迎的PHP框架,而Vue是目前流行的一款前端框架,如何在Laravel中部署Vue呢?下面我們一起來看看。
首先,我們需要在Laravel中安裝Vue,具體操作如下:
npm install vue
安裝好Vue之后,我們需要在項目中新建一個resources/assets/js目錄,用于存放Vue的文件。然后,我們需要在webpack.mix.js中添加下面的代碼:
// 引入Vue
let mix = require('laravel-mix');
mix.js('resources/assets/js/app.js', 'public/js')
.sass('resources/assets/sass/app.scss', 'public/css');
然后我們可以將Vue組件寫在resources/assets/js/app.js文件中。例如:
Vue.component('example-component', require('./components/ExampleComponent.vue'));
const app = new Vue({
el: '#app'
});
接下來我們需要將Vue文件打包,具體方式如下:
// 執行
npm run dev
這樣即可將Vue文件打包到public/js/app.js中,我們可以在視圖文件中引入打包后的文件。
<div id="app">
<example-component></example-component>
</div>
...
<script src="{{ asset('js/app.js') }}"></script>
如此一來,我們便順利地在Laravel中部署了Vue。
上一篇html js 輪播代碼
下一篇e語言json取通用屬性